Abstract

We report a case of spina bifida in the upper thoracic spine with an accompanying meningocoele suspected at 8 weeks' gestation via transvaginal sonography and confirmed at 13 weeks' gestation via 3-dimensional sonography. The fetal cranial vault and intracranial structures were normal. The only finding in the 8-week sonogram was a subtle angulation or "step" in the posterior contour of the embryo; this may be attributed to kyphosis, which often accompanies this condition. The presence of a "step" in the fetal contour must alert the sonologist to the possibility of spina bifida. To our knowledge, this is the earliest antenatal diagnosis of spina bifida.
